Sometimes healing feels more like trial and error than progress. Brian Livesay knows that firsthand. After a decade in uniform and years working in veteran care, he’s learned that recovery is about connection, honesty, and finding what actually works for each person. In this conversation, Brian and Scott talk about how therapy can go wrong when it’s too rigid, the fear of making that first call for help, and why moral injury still gets overlooked in veteran care. It’s a hopeful look at what happens when we stop trying to “fit” into a treatment plan and start listening to what we really need.
